Yep yep, he's in england, where they actually had a 96 1.8T... finding the #'s might be difficult cause of that, in NA they started offering the 1.8T in 97 -- I'd bet all the stats are the same as the 97, I dont think they made a single change... cept for rear plate thing was changed in 97 (made narrower for our plates) but that'd obviously only be a north american change.
